[PATCH v2 1/4] powerpc: hard_irq_disable(): Call trace_hardirqs_off after disabling

Scott Wood scottwood at freescale.com
Fri May 10 13:09:41 EST 2013


lockdep.c has this:
        /*
         * So we're supposed to get called after you mask local IRQs,
         * but for some reason the hardware doesn't quite think you did
         * a proper job.
         */
	if (DEBUG_LOCKS_WARN_ON(!irqs_disabled()))
		return;

Since irqs_disabled() is based on soft_enabled(), that (not just the
hard EE bit) needs to be 0 before we call trace_hardirqs_off.

 arch/powerpc/include/asm/hw_irq.h |    5 +++--
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/arch/powerpc/include/asm/hw_irq.h b/arch/powerpc/include/asm/hw_irq.h
index d615b28..ba713f1 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/include/asm/hw_irq.h
+++ b/arch/powerpc/include/asm/hw_irq.h
@@ -96,11 +96,12 @@ static inline bool arch_irqs_disabled(void)
 #endif
 
 #define hard_irq_disable()	do {			\
+	u8 _was_enabled = get_paca()->soft_enabled;	\
 	__hard_irq_disable();				\
-	if (local_paca->soft_enabled)			\
-		trace_hardirqs_off();			\
 	get_paca()->soft_enabled = 0;			\
 	get_paca()->irq_happened |= PACA_IRQ_HARD_DIS;	\
+	if (_was_enabled)				\
+		trace_hardirqs_off();			\
 } while(0)
